IP查询
查询
你查询的IP:[118.89.146.197] 地理位置:中国–上海–上海
最新查询
210.82.169.7
60.208.99.13
210.28.248.210
218.192.242.64
58.100.205.175
124.112.12.184
122.240.81.212
124.249.208.222
116.192.12.212
118.89.146.197
119.232.24.214
203.212.96.120
211.80.50.84
124.192.140.254
202.170.128.35
222.125.123.73
221.199.128.66
203.89.30.174
61.4.176.145
117.103.128.106
118.212.227.237
117.80.6.49
116.16.56.134
117.32.145.68
117.40.155.7
202.122.64.38
124.250.14.154
210.51.108.235
123.184.160.183
120.30.208.193
221.198.166.158